Saudi King Salman Expresses Condolences to Kuwait Emir After Deadly Fire

In response to the tragic fire that claimed the lives of many in Kuwait, King Salman of Saudi Arabia reached out to Emir Sheikh Meshal Al-Ahmad Al-Jaber Al-Sabah with a heartfelt message of condolence and sympathy.

Expressing his sorrow, the king stated, “We learned of the news of the outbreak of a fire in the Mangaf region, and the deaths and injuries that resulted from it, and we send to Your Highness, to the families of the deceased, and to the brotherly people of the State of Kuwait, our warmest and most sincere condolences.”

He also extended his wishes for a speedy recovery to those who were injured in the tragic incident, as reported by the Saudi Press Agency.

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man also joined in expressing his condolences, sending messages to both the emir and Crown Prince Sheikh Sabah Khaled Al-Hamad Al-Mubarak Al-Sabah.

The Kuwaiti government confirmed that forty-nine people lost their lives in the fire that engulfed a building housing nearly 200 foreign workers. The blaze, which started in the early hours of the morning in a six-story building south of Kuwait City, also left many others injured, according to the health ministry.
